Quaker instant oatmeal, maple and brown sugar, dry calories and nutrition facts
100 grams of quaker instant oatmeal, maple and brown sugar, dry contains 368 calories, with 9.2 g of protein, 76.9 g of carbohydrate and 4.6 g of fat. It provides 7.2 g of fiber and 30 g of sugar per 100 g. Most of its calories come from carbohydrate.
Where the calories come from
Protein 10% Carbs 80% Fat 10%

Nutrition facts for quaker instant oatmeal, maple and brown sugar, dry
| Nutrient | Per 100 g |
|---|---|
| Calories | 368 kcal |
| Protein | 9.2 g |
| Carbohydrate | 76.9 g |
| Fat | 4.6 g |
| Fiber | 7.2 g |
| Sugar | 30 g |
| Saturated fat | 0.8 g |
| Salt | 1.3 g |

Vitamins and minerals in quaker instant oatmeal, maple and brown sugar, dry
Per 100 g, highest share of the Daily Value first. %DV = the adult Daily Value (FDA reference). USDA reference data — not medical advice.
| Nutrient | Per 100 g | %DV |
|---|---|---|
| Manganese | 2.2 mg | 98% |
| Vitamin B6 | 1.2 mg | 71% |
| Riboflavin (B2) | 0.91 mg | 70% |
| Niacin (B3) | 10.7 mg | 67% |
| Vitamin A | 520 µg | 58% |
| Iron | 8.2 mg | 46% |
| Thiamin (B1) | 0.52 mg | 43% |
| Selenium | 15.8 µg | 29% |

Calories in common quaker instant oatmeal, maple and brown sugar, dry servings
How many calories in a portion of quaker instant oatmeal, maple and brown sugar, dry — reference serving estimates with the gram weight shown.
| Serving | Calories | Protein | Carbs | Fat |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 packet (43 g) | 158 kcal | 4 g | 33 g | 2 g |
| 100 g (100 g) | 368 kcal | 9 g | 77 g | 5 g |
